Machen Sie die Bildlaufleiste in ionischen Inhalten sichtbar, wenn Sie native Bildlauffunktionen verwenden.
Ich benutzeoverflow-scroll = "true"
, um ionisches Scrollen zu ermöglichen:
<ion-content overflow-scroll = "true">
<ion-list>
<ion-item ng-repeat="foo in bar">
{{foo.label}}
</ion-item>
</ion-list>
</ion-content>
Das funktioniert wirklich gut (die Leistungen sind wirklich gut). Das einzige Problem ist, dass die (vertikale) Bildlaufleiste verschwunden ist.
Wie nach demDokumentatio, Ich habe versucht, @ hinzuzufügscrollbar-y="true"
zuion-content
, aber das hat nicht funktioniert.
Ich habe auch versucht, dies zu meinem CSS hinzuzufügen:
::-webkit-scrollbar {
-webkit-appearance: none;
}
::-webkit-scrollbar:vertical {
width: 11px;
}
::-webkit-scrollbar:horizontal {
height: 11px;
}
::-webkit-scrollbar-thumb {
border-radius: 8px;
border: 2px solid white;
background-color: rgba(0, 0, 0, .5);
}
::-webkit-scrollbar-track {
background-color: #fff;
border-radius: 8px;
}
... aber das hat auch nicht funktioniert.
Dieser Artike (suche nach "native scrolling") sagt, dass das Problem mit CSS gelöst werden kann.
Weiß jemand, wie es geht?